M. Alex O. Vasilescu, PhD., is the Director of UCLA Computer Vision & Graphics Lab & the CSO of Tensor Vision. Dr. Alex is an expert in Computer Vision & Tensor Framework. She received her education at the Massachusetts Institute of Technology & the University of Toronto. She was a research scientist at the MIT Media Lab & at New York Universitys Courant Institute of Mathematical Sciences.

In the early 2000s, Dr. Alex introduced the tensor algebraic framework for computer vision, computer graphics, machine learning, & generalized concepts from linear algebra to tensor algebra. She addressed causal inferencing questions by framing computer graphics & computer vision as multilinear problems. This has yielded powerful statistical methods that demonstratively disentangled the causal factors of data formation. Causal inferencing in a tensor framework facilitates the analysis, recognition, synthesis, & interpretability of sensory data. The development of the tensor framework has been spearheaded with premier papers, such as: Human Motion Signatures (2001), TensorFaces(2002), MICA(2005), TensorTextures(2003), & Multilinear Projection for Recognition (2007, 2011).

Dr. Alexs work was featured on the cover of Computer World Canada (currently, IT World Canada), & in articles in the New York Times, Washington Times, etc. MIT's Technology Review named her as TR100 honoree, & the National Academy of Science co-awarded the KeckFutures Initiative Grant.
